Top Roof Recommendations for a Naturally Cool and Comfortable Home

Choosing the right roof for your house is not just about visual appeal; it is a matter of long-term living comfort. In a tropical country like Indonesia, intense heat makes material selection a critical factor in keeping a home cool and pleasant to live in. Therefore, it is essential to choose roofing that is capable of reducing heat while offering excellent durability.
 

Best Roofing Options for a Cooler Home

1. UPVC Roofing: The Ultimate Solution for a Cooler House

Currently, UPVC roofing stands as one of the best choices for modern residences. This material possesses superior heat and sound insulation properties compared to many conventional roofing types. Additionally, UPVC roofs are corrosion-resistant, do not rot over time, and are perfectly suited for both residential homes and commercial buildings. Certain premium UPVC roof types are even engineered specifically to keep indoor temperatures comfortable, even under scorching direct sunlight.
 

2. Sand-Coated Metal Roofing for Added Comfort

Sand-coated metal roof tiles (genteng metal pasir) have become a favorite choice because they seamlessly combine the structural strength of metal with a granular sand layer that helps dampen heat and the sound of heavy rain. In addition to being lightweight, their installation process is significantly faster than traditional tiles. The textured sand coating on the surface provides the added value of extra indoor comfort and a more elegant exterior look.
 

3. Spandek Roofing for Modern Construction

For those who prioritize efficiency and modern architectural design, spandek roofing can be an excellent solution. This material is widely recognized for being lightweight, exceptionally strong, and highly resilient against various weather conditions. To optimize its thermal performance, spandek roofing can be easily paired with additional under-roof insulation to ensure the living space beneath stays comfortable.
 

Tips for Choosing a Roof to Keep Your Home Cool

  • Prioritize Insulation: Select materials that possess excellent natural heat insulation properties.
  • Opt for Lighter Colors: Use lighter roof colors to effectively reflect solar heat away from the building.
  • Optimize Ventilation: Ensure your home's roof and attic ventilation systems flow optimally to prevent trapped heat.
